When It Comes Around

My thought reek of bloopers
All I see is blue birds
Ever since you left me
Maybe I deserve it
A southpaw has to be used to this

Sleeping in the mud
Reminiscing the dirty games I played
Staring at the dice
you flipped on me
I hate how the tables turned
Used to mishandle the lighter
look at how I got burned

Flames of anger
puff out of the words I breathe
I was stupid for thinking winners never lose
I've learnt the best lesson in the worst way
I know my stars were cursed
for how I kept many in the dark

Cloud of lies
Crazy how I rained promises on them
Only to let ignorant fairies drown in disappointment
Spare me the regrets
I deserve this stunt
The wrongs I did hid in my shadow
The future looks uncertain
Still feeling reluctant to change
from those ways

Honestly
Breezes from my past don't feel good
The maybes will probably fade
If I start being true to myself
and the few in my world
I pray the earth helps me now
Or it will be forced to hold me down in the end

Copyright © Khofi Mink | Year Posted 2018
